Mrs. Evelena (Lena) Bodman, 97,
died Thursday at 8:30 p.m. at the
Lutheran Homes where she had been
making her home.
She was born Feb. 26, 1870 at Mus-
catine, the daughter of Bernhard
and Lena Rothe Miller. She married
William B. Bodman May 4, 1892, at
Muscatine. Mrs. Bodnian was a mem-
ber of the Methodist church.
Survivors include a daughter, Mrs.
A.F. (Florence) Witte, Boca Raton,
Fla.; one grandson, Dr. R.V. Witte,
Grand Junction, Colo.; and two
great-grandchildren.
Preceding her in death were her
parents, husband, one son, two
brothers and five sisters.
Funeral service will be held Satur-
day, Oct. 21 at 10:30 a.m. at the
George M. Wittich Funeral home.
Rev. L. A. Stumme of the Lutheran
Homes will officiate. Burial will
be at Memorial Park cemetery.
